четверг, 22 апреля 2010 г.

Про overflow:hidden в Internet Explorer

Internet Explorer очень загадочно ведет себя с overflow: hidden и position: relative.

Допустим, у вас есть следующее DOM-дерево:
  <div style="height: 80px; overflow: hidden; width: 200px;">
    <div style="position: relative; width: 2000px;">
      content
    </div>
  </div>


С помощью этого кода получается отличный слайдер. Но! Он заставляет IE6/7 в ужасе вылетать.

Далее под катом

среда, 21 апреля 2010 г.

Packages in Symfony

В doctrine schema.yml можно указать параметр package: ololo. Тогда классы создатутся в папочке ololo, но ещё появится папочка packages, в которой будут плагиновые классы (Plugin*) тоже в папочке ololo. А наследование будет следующее Base*→Plugin*→наш класс.

Почему пакеты связаны с плагинами настолько не очень понятно. И почему нигде в интернетах ни слова про пакеты – тоже непонятно.